Vapor Pressure Calculator for Solutions
Calculate the vapor pressure of a solution using Raoult’s Law for a nonvolatile solute or for an ideal binary volatile mixture.
Results
Enter values and click calculate to see total vapor pressure and component contributions.
How to calculate the vapor pressure of a solution accurately
Vapor pressure is one of the most important thermodynamic properties in chemistry, chemical engineering, environmental modeling, and process safety. If you are trying to calculate the vapor pressure of a solution, the method depends on what type of solution you have and how ideal the mixture behavior is. In the simplest case, a nonvolatile solute lowers the vapor pressure of a solvent according to Raoult’s Law. In mixed volatile liquids, each component contributes a partial pressure and the total pressure is the sum of those partial pressures.
The calculator above is built for fast practical work. It handles two common cases. First, a nonvolatile solute dissolved in a volatile solvent, which is typical in colligative property problems such as salt in water. Second, an ideal binary volatile system where both components evaporate, such as many solvent blends used in lab and industrial settings. For each case, it estimates pure component saturation pressure using the Antoine equation, then computes total vapor pressure from composition.
Core equations you need
- Antoine equation: log10(P*) = A – B / (C + T), where P* is pure component vapor pressure in mmHg and T is in °C.
- Raoult’s Law for nonvolatile solute: Psolution = Xsolvent × P*solvent.
- Raoult’s Law for ideal binary volatile mixture: Ptotal = XA × P*A + XB × P*B, with XB = 1 – XA.
- Vapor pressure lowering: DeltaP = P*solvent – Psolution.
These equations are accurate for many dilute and near ideal systems. For strongly nonideal behavior, activity coefficients are required. Still, these formulas are the correct starting point for most educational, lab, and quick screening calculations.
Step by step method for a nonvolatile solute in a solvent
- Choose the solvent and temperature.
- Find the pure solvent vapor pressure at that temperature, often from Antoine constants or a trusted vapor pressure table.
- Convert solvent mass and solute mass to moles.
- Compute solvent mole fraction in the liquid phase: Xsolvent = nsolvent / (nsolvent + nsolute).
- Multiply Xsolvent by pure solvent pressure P*solvent to get Psolution.
- Optionally compute pressure lowering for colligative analysis.
Example: 100 g water with 10 g sodium chloride equivalent dissolved species (molar mass input based on your model assumptions). At 25°C, pure water pressure is around 23.8 mmHg. If the resulting solvent mole fraction is 0.97, the estimated solution vapor pressure is 0.97 × 23.8 = 23.1 mmHg. This reduction may look small, but it is enough to affect humidity control, boiling point elevation, and drying operations.
Step by step method for ideal binary volatile mixtures
- Select two volatile components and a temperature.
- Estimate each pure saturation pressure (P*A and P*B) using Antoine constants.
- Enter liquid composition as mole fraction XA.
- Compute partial pressure of A: PA = XA × P*A.
- Compute partial pressure of B: PB = (1 – XA) × P*B.
- Add them: Ptotal = PA + PB.
This is the standard ideal solution approach used in introductory VLE calculations. It works best when molecular interactions are similar between unlike and like molecules. For mixtures with strong hydrogen bonding or polarity mismatch, measured values can deviate significantly and may require models such as Wilson, NRTL, or UNIQUAC.
| Compound | Normal boiling point (°C) | Vapor pressure at 25°C (mmHg) | Typical use context |
|---|---|---|---|
| Water | 100.0 | 23.8 | Aqueous systems, environmental processes |
| Ethanol | 78.37 | 59.0 | Lab solvent, biofuels, extraction |
| Benzene | 80.1 | 95.2 | Organic chemistry reference system |
| Acetone | 56.05 | 231.0 | Fast evaporating solvent operations |
These values are widely reported in engineering handbooks and thermodynamic databases. They immediately show why solvent selection matters. Acetone can create a much higher vapor load at room temperature than water, which impacts ventilation design and operator exposure controls. Benzene and ethanol have moderately high values at 25°C, while water remains comparatively low.
Temperature sensitivity and why your result can shift quickly
Vapor pressure is strongly temperature dependent. A small temperature increase often causes a large pressure rise, especially near ambient conditions for low boiling liquids. This is why process specifications should include temperature control and why calculators must always ask for temperature as an input instead of using a fixed assumption.
| Water temperature (°C) | Approximate vapor pressure (kPa) | Approximate vapor pressure (mmHg) |
|---|---|---|
| 20 | 2.34 | 17.5 |
| 25 | 3.17 | 23.8 |
| 30 | 4.24 | 31.8 |
| 40 | 7.38 | 55.3 |
| 60 | 19.9 | 149.4 |
Notice the increase from 20°C to 40°C: vapor pressure more than triples. This trend drives faster evaporation, higher headspace concentration, and increased condenser duty in separation systems. It also explains why drying curves and shelf life predictions are temperature sensitive.
Real world reliability: ideal versus nonideal behavior
In practical applications, you should judge whether ideal assumptions are acceptable. Raoult based calculations are often reasonable for:
- Dilute nonvolatile solutes in a dominant solvent.
- Chemically similar solvents with close intermolecular forces.
- Early stage screening where order of magnitude is enough.
You should move to activity coefficient models when:
- Mixtures show positive or negative deviations from ideality.
- Hydrogen bonding is strong and composition dependent.
- Design decisions depend on tight margins, such as distillation tray count or emissions compliance.
Practical rule: if your quick calculation differs significantly from measured lab data, treat that as expected behavior, not a calculator failure. The equation can be correct while the model assumptions are not.
Common mistakes to avoid
- Using mass fraction instead of mole fraction in Raoult’s Law.
- Mixing pressure units without conversion.
- Applying constants outside their valid temperature range.
- Assuming solute is nonvolatile when it actually contributes to vapor phase.
- Ignoring dissociation effects for electrolytes if you are doing colligative property interpretation.
- Using rounded molecular weights too aggressively in high precision work.
Where to validate your data and constants
For trustworthy calculations, use authoritative sources for vapor pressure data and thermodynamic constants. Recommended references include:
- NIST Chemistry WebBook (.gov) for vapor pressure and Antoine data.
- U.S. EPA property estimation resources (.gov) for environmental modeling support.
- Chemistry LibreTexts (.edu) for educational derivations and worked examples.
Engineering and laboratory applications
Vapor pressure calculations are used every day in chemical handling, product formulation, atmospheric science, and pharmaceutical process development. In solvent blending, they help estimate VOC emissions and determine if local exhaust ventilation is adequate. In crystallization and drying, they shape operating temperature choices and pressure set points. In education, they connect molecular concepts to measurable macroscopic behavior.
If your goal is operational safety, combine vapor pressure estimates with exposure limits, flash point data, and air exchange rates. If your goal is separation design, pair this calculation with phase equilibrium diagrams and activity coefficient fitting. If your goal is quality control, compare predicted and measured values over several batches to monitor formulation drift.
Quick interpretation guide for the calculator output
- Pure component pressure: baseline volatility at the selected temperature.
- Partial pressure: component contribution to the vapor phase.
- Total vapor pressure: sum of all volatile contributions.
- Pressure lowering: reduction caused by dissolved nonvolatile solute.
Use the chart to compare magnitudes quickly. If total pressure is far below pure solvent pressure in the nonvolatile model, solute concentration is strongly suppressing evaporation. In the binary model, large differences in pure component volatility will heavily skew partial pressure contributions even when liquid composition seems balanced.
Final takeaway
To calculate the vapor pressure of a solution of dissolved species, always begin with the right physical model, accurate temperature input, and reliable pure component data. Raoult’s Law gives a strong first estimate and is often sufficient for planning, education, and many practical calculations. For critical design and compliance tasks, validate against measured data and switch to nonideal thermodynamic models when needed. The calculator on this page is designed to deliver fast, transparent, and technically sound estimates while keeping each assumption visible.